دستور SUM در SQL







دستور SUM در SQL

دستور SUM در SQL

دستور SUM در SQL یکی از دستورات پرکاربرد در زبان برنامه‌نویسی SQL است. این دستور برای محاسبه مجموع مقادیری که در یک ستون قرار دارند، استفاده می‌شود. با استفاده از دستور SUM، می‌توانید مجموع اعداد را در یک ستون مشخص کنید و نتیجه را به صورت یک عدد بازگردانید.

دستور SUM در SQL – نحوه استفاده

برای استفاده از دستور SUM در SQL، ابتدا باید نام ستونی که می‌خواهید مجموع مقادیر آن را محاسبه کنید را مشخص کنید. سپس از دستور SUM استفاده کرده و نام ستون را به عنوان پارامتر ورودی به آن بدهید. در نهایت، نتیجه مجموع را دریافت خواهید کرد.

دستور SUM در SQL – مثال

فرض کنید یک جدول به نام “فروش” داریم که شامل دو ستون “محصول” و “قیمت” است. می‌خواهیم مجموع قیمت‌ها را محاسبه کنیم. به صورت زیر می‌توانیم این کار را انجام دهیم:

SELECT SUM(قیمت) AS مجموع_قیمت FROM فروش;

در این مثال، دستور SELECT برای انتخاب مجموع قیمت‌ها استفاده می‌شود. SUM(قیمت) به عنوان پارامتر ورودی به دستور SUM ارسال می‌شود و نتیجه مجموع قیمت‌ها با نام “مجموع_قیمت” برگردانده می‌شود.

دستور SUM در SQL – مورد استفاده

دستور SUM در SQL در موارد مختلفی مورد استفاده قرار می‌گیرد. برخی از این موارد عبارتند از:

  • محاسبه مجموع اعداد در یک ستون جدول
  • محاسبه مجموع اعداد براساس شرایط خاص
  • محاسبه مجموع اعداد در چند ستون مختلف

دستور SUM در SQL – محاسبه مجموع اعداد در یک ستون جدول

یکی از استفاده‌های رایج دستور SUM در SQL، محاسبه مجموع اعداد در یک ستون جدول است. با استفاده از دستور SUM می‌توانید مجموع مقادیر عددی را محاسبه کنید و نتیجه را به صورت یک عدد بازگردانید. برای محاسبه مجموع اعداد در یک ستون جدول، از دستور SUM به صورت زیر استفاده می‌شود:

SELECT SUM(نام_ستون) AS نام_نتیجه FROM نام_جدول;

در این دستور، نام_ستون نام ستونی است که می‌خواهید مجموع مقادیر آن را محاسبه کنید و نام_جدول نام جدولی است که ستون در آن قرار دارد. نتیجه محاسبه مجموع به صورت یک ستون با نام نام_نتیجه برگردانده می‌شود.

دستور SUM در SQL – محاسبه مجموع اعداد براساس شرایط خاص

در برخی موارد، ممکن است نیاز داشته باشید مجموع اعداد را براساس شرایط خاصی محاسبه کنید. برای این کار، می‌توانید از جمله WHERE استفاده کنید تا شرایط مورد نظر را برای محاسبه مجموع تعیین کنید. مثال زیر نحوه استفاده از دستور SUM با شرایط خاص را نشان می‌دهد:

SELECT SUM(نام_ستون) AS نام_نتیجه FROM نام_جدول WHERE شرط;

در این مثال، نام_ستون نام ستونی است که می‌خواهید مجموع مقادیر آن را براساس شرایطی که در بخش WHERE تعیین می‌کنید، محاسبه کنید. نتیجه محاسبه مجموع به صورت یک ستون با نام نام_نتیجه برگردانده می‌شود.

دستور SUM در SQL – محاسبه مجموع اعداد در چند ستون مختلف

دستور SUM در SQL به شما امکان می‌دهد مجموع اعداد را در چند ستون مختلف محاسبه کنید. برای این کار، نیاز است نام ستون‌های مورد نظر را جداگانه به دستور SUM ارسال کنید. مثال زیر نحوه استفاده از دستور SUM برای محاسبه مجموع اعداد در چند ستون مختلف را نشان می‌دهد:

SELECT SUM(ستون1) AS نتیجه_ستون1, SUM(ستون2) AS نتیجه_ستون2, SUM(ستون3) AS نتیجه_ستون3 FROM نام_جدول;

در این مثال، ستون1، ستون2 و ستون3 نام ستون‌هایی هستند که می‌خواهید مجموع مقادیر آن‌ها را محاسبه کنید و نام_جدول نام جدولی است که ستون‌ها در آن قرار دارند. نتیجه محاسبه مجموع به صورت چند ستون با نام‌های نتیجه_ستون1، نتیجه_ستون2 و نتیجه_ستون3 برگردانده می‌شود.

دستور SUM در SQL – سوالات متداول

در ادامه، به برخی از سوالات متداول در مورد دستور SUM در SQL پاسخ خواهیم داد:

چگونه می‌توانیم مجموع اعداد را در یک ستون جدول محاسبه کنیم؟

برای محاسبه مجموع اعداد در یک ستون جدول در SQL، از دستور SUM به صورت زیر استفاده کنید:

SELECT SUM(نام_ستون) FROM نام_جدول;

آیا می‌توانیم دستور SUM را برای محاسبه مجموع اعداد در چند ستون مختلف استفاده کنیم؟

بله، می‌توانید دستور SUM را برای محاسبه مجموع اعداد در چند ستون مختلف استفاده کنید. به ازای هر ستون مورد نظر، از دستور SUM به صورت زیر استفاده کنید:

SELECT SUM(ستون1), SUM(ستون2), SUM(ستون3) FROM نام_جدول;

آیا می‌توانیم دستور SUM را برای محاسبه مجموع اعداد براساس شرایط خاص استفاده کنیم؟

بله، می‌توانید دستور SUM را برای محاسبه مجموع اعداد براساس شرایط خاص استفاده کنید. برای این کار، از جمله WHERE استفاده کنید تا شرایط مورد نظر را تعیین کنید. مثال زیر نحوه استفاده از دستور SUM با شرایط خاص را نشان می‌دهد:

SELECT SUM(نام_ستون) FROM نام_جدول WHERE شرط;

نتیجه

در این مقاله، به معرفی و استفاده از دستور SUM در SQL پرداختیم. دستور SUM به شما امکان می‌دهد مجموع اعداد را در یک ستون جدول، براساس شرایط خاص یا در چند ستون مختلف محاسبه کنید. با استف